public void RemoveFirstできる() { linkedList = new ShosLinkedList2 <int> { 60, 30, 20 }; linkedList.RemoveFirst(); AssertExtensions.AreEqual(new[] { 30, 20 }, linkedList); linkedList.RemoveFirst(); AssertExtensions.AreEqual(new[] { 20 }, linkedList); linkedList.RemoveFirst(); AssertExtensions.AreEqual(new int[] { }, linkedList); }
public void RemoveFirstTest2() { for (var number = 1; number <= dataNumber; number++) { linkedList2.RemoveFirst(); } }
public void 空のときRemoveFirstすると例外が飛ぶ() => linkedList.RemoveFirst();